Site Preparation
One of the most important things before installing high strength steel wire is proper site preparation. You need to make sure the area where the wire will be installed is clean and free of any debris. If there are rocks, dirt, or other obstacles, they can interfere with the installation process and even cause damage to the wire.
Measure the area accurately. This is crucial because high strength steel wire is often cut to specific lengths. A wrong measurement can lead to a wire that's either too short or too long, which can be a real headache. Use a reliable measuring tool, like a tape measure, and double - check your measurements.
Safety First
Safety should always be your top priority when installing high strength steel wire. Wear appropriate safety gear, such as gloves and safety glasses. The wire can be sharp, and there's always a risk of cuts or eye injuries if you're not careful.
If you're working at height, make sure you have proper fall protection equipment. High strength steel wire is sometimes used in tall structures, and a fall can be extremely dangerous. Also, make sure the installation area is well - ventilated, especially if you're using any chemicals or adhesives during the installation process.
Handling the Wire
When handling high strength steel wire, be gentle. It may be strong, but it can still be damaged if mishandled. Avoid kinking or bending the wire too sharply. Kinks can weaken the wire and reduce its strength, which is definitely not what you want.
Use the right tools for the job. A good pair of wire cutters is essential for cutting the wire to the correct length. Make sure the cutters are sharp so that you can get a clean cut. If you're joining the wire, use appropriate connectors. These connectors need to be strong enough to hold the wire securely.
Installation Process
The installation process can vary depending on the application. For example, if you're using high strength steel wire for fencing, you'll need to install posts first. The posts should be firmly anchored in the ground. You can use concrete to secure the posts for added stability.
Attach the wire to the posts. There are different methods for doing this, such as using staples or clips. Make sure the wire is pulled tight. A loose wire won't be as effective, especially in applications where it needs to provide support or security.
If you're using high strength steel wire in a construction project, like for reinforcement, follow the design specifications carefully. The wire may need to be placed at specific intervals and in a particular pattern. Deviating from the design can compromise the integrity of the structure.
Tensioning
Tensioning the high strength steel wire is a critical step. The right tension ensures that the wire functions properly. Use a tensioning device to achieve the correct tension. This device can help you measure and adjust the tension accurately.
Too much tension can cause the wire to break, while too little tension can result in a wire that's loose and ineffective. Check the tension regularly during the installation process to make sure it remains consistent.


Inspection
Once the installation is complete, inspect the high strength steel wire thoroughly. Look for any signs of damage, such as cuts, kinks, or loose connections. If you find any issues, address them immediately.
Check the tension again to make sure it's still within the acceptable range. This post - installation inspection can help you catch any problems early on and prevent future issues.
Maintenance
High strength steel wire generally requires less maintenance compared to other materials, but it still needs some attention. Regularly inspect the wire for signs of corrosion. Although high strength steel wire is often coated to resist corrosion, the coating can wear off over time.
If you notice any corrosion, clean the affected area and apply a corrosion - resistant coating. This can help extend the lifespan of the wire. Also, check the connectors and tension periodically to make sure they're still in good condition.

Environmental Considerations
Consider the environmental conditions where the high strength steel wire will be installed. If the area is prone to high humidity or extreme temperatures, the wire may need to be treated or coated differently. For example, in a coastal area with high salt content in the air, a wire with a more corrosion - resistant coating may be necessary.
If the installation is in an area with a lot of sunlight, UV - resistant coatings can help prevent the wire from deteriorating over time. Think about these environmental factors before you start the installation process.
